How to use /NFM/RATS1 - Maintain Rates, SD


/NFM/RATS1 - Overview

  • Transaction Code: /NFM/RATS1

    Description: Maintain Rates, SD

    Release: S/4HANA and ECC 6

    Menu Path:

    • Logistics > Sales and Distribution > Master Data > NF Metal Processing > Rates > Maintain Rates
    • Logistics > Customer Service > Service Processing > Environment > Sales and Distribution > Master Data > NF Metal Processing > Rates > Maintain Rates
    • Logistics > Customer Service > Service Agreements > Environment > Sales and Distribution > Master Data > NF Metal Processing > Rates > Maintain Rates
  • Show technical details Hide technical details
    • Program: /NFM/SAPLRATES

      Screen: 100

      Authorization Object:

    • Development Package: /NFM/SD

      Package Description: NF Metal Processing: SD

      Parent Package: /NFM/MAIN

    • Module/Component: IS-MP-NF

      Description: Non-Ferrous Metal enhancements
